Tara Mavrovitis ('13) is the Head of Governance, Risk, and Compliance (GRC) and Head of Internal Audit at Collibra, where she leads the company's global governance, risk, compliance, and internal audit programs. Since joining Collibra in 2020, she has advanced through several leadership roles and has helped shape the company's approach to security, compliance, risk management, and AI governance.

Before Collibra, Tara held audit and risk leadership positions at The Estée Lauder Companies, Loews Corporation, Omnicom, and PwC, building expertise in internal audit, IT risk, compliance, and fraud investigations across a variety of industries.

A 2013 graduate of ÀÖ²¥´«Ã½'s School of Management, Tara earned honors in Accounting and Management with a concentration in Leadership and Consulting, along with a minor in Graphic Design. She remains actively engaged in mentoring and advancing women in leadership and technology.

Jatinder Koharki ’04 is a business leader, author, and entrepreneur who has built a dynamic career at the intersection of corporate consulting and creative storytelling. A graduate of ÀÖ²¥´«Ã½â€™s School of Management, she earned her degree in Finance and Management Information Systems before going on to receive her MBA in Strategic Leadership from Penn State’s Smeal College of Business.

Professionally, Jatinder spent more than 20 years in Client Services, currently serving as a Client Relationship Executive at Deloitte. She now consults with various organizations, bringing together firm capabilities and client needs while strengthening executive-level relationships. Known for bridging the gap between business leaders and technology teams, Jatinder ensures solutions are strategically aligned and effectively executed.

Alongside her corporate career, she is the Founder and Owner of Book for Every Nook Publications LLC and a published author of both fiction and non-fiction works. As an author and blogger, she remains committed to continuous learning, thoughtful leadership, and creative exploration.

Josiah Dillon ('18) is an MBA Strategy Intern at DICK'S Sporting Goods and an MBA candidate at the University of Virginia Darden School of Business. Before business school, he served as an officer in the United States Marine Corps, where he led teams of up to 160 Marines in operations, communications, and leadership roles. He later served as an Officer Selection Officer, recruiting and mentoring future Marine officers across 27 universities in Indiana.

A 2018 graduate of ÀÖ²¥´«Ã½'s School of Management, Josiah earned a Bachelor of Science in Business Administration with a concentration in Finance, graduating cum laude. His background in military leadership and business strategy gives him a unique perspective on leading teams, solving complex challenges, and building successful organizations.

Clifford Sobel ('84) is a Psychologically Informed Coach and Mental Health Counselor (MHC-LP) at The Midtown Practice for Psychotherapy and Psychiatry in New York City. Drawing on more than 35 years as an entrepreneur and CEO, he helps professionals strengthen leadership, build resilience, prevent burnout, and navigate personal and workplace challenges.

Before transitioning into mental health counseling, Clifford founded and led The Phoenix Group, an e-learning and corporate training company that partnered with Fortune 500 organizations, including Xerox, Canon, Johnson & Johnson, and Discovery Networks. He later founded The Streamcast Network, helping organizations leverage live video and digital media to grow their brands.

A 1984 graduate of ÀÖ²¥´«Ã½, Clifford recently earned a Master of Science in Mental Health Counseling from Pace University and is passionate about helping individuals achieve both professional success and personal well-being.
